> I noticed this while experimenting with the new list compactions command.   If a tablets server queues a compaction for a sub set of files and then a user request a compaction of all files, then the users reuqest should preempt the system.  The compaction queue sorts so that this should happen, but compactions are not added if anything is on the queue.
